Bug Description

The read-pdf module includes some generally useful code:

1. Streaming between Java and C++
2. The java.library.path hack to allow Java to call back into C++

These should be moved into the util-jvm module for use by other modules.

Moving at least (2) may be challenging as it will require making some kind of general-purpose way to access that hack.
